177 mass media representatives killed in 2007 - UN
Almaty. May 4. Kazakhstan Today - 177 mass media representatives were killed in 2007, the agency reports referring to UN news service.
According to the news service, on the eve of the World Press Freedom Day of the UNESCO referring to the International federation of journalists has drawn attention to the fact that in 2007 177 mass media representatives were killed. The unprecedented number of journalists has been attacked or killed in Iraq."
The committee for protection of journalists informed that only 15 % out of 500 cases of murders of journalists led to sentence pronouncement for the last 15 years, the news service informs.
According to the message, on the occasion of World Press Freedom Day, the committee made the index of impunity public. This list icludes 13 countries, the authorities of which cannot or do not wish to call to account the guilty in deliberate murders of the employees of mass media. The first three included Iraq, Sierra Leon and Somalia where journalists routinely endanger their lives while covering operations. "The index of impunity included the countries where for the last 10 years at least 5 murders of journalists have not been disclosed. Russia occupies the 9th place in this list.
In UNESCO opinion, today attacks on journalists have ceased to be a rarity. Carrying out their professional duty, in particular, covering of operations, social conflicts or natural accidents, they endanger their lives, but as the news service of the United Nations informs, "the greatest alarm causes those cases when journalists become a target because of the materials published by them."

Oil spill detected in Caspian Sea
According to space monitoring data, received from Sentinel-1A (02:43 UTC), an oil spill was detected on March 30 in the area of Kashagan field in the Caspian Sea. The spill area is about 7 square kilometers. The spill was drifting to the north of the Caspian Sea," the publication reads.
If these facts are confirmed by Atyrau region’s Ecology Department, unscheduled inspection will be conducted at the North Caspian Operating Company. The results will be reported additionally," the Ecology Committee says.
